The Start-ups in London Libraries programme

This programme includes sessions to be held at West Norwood Library. It is designed to help aspiring and early-stage entrepreneurs from all walks of life to turn their business idea into a reality, or to elevate their new business to the next stage. Through a network of 10 London borough libraries, they deliver grass roots business support almost directly to your doorstep.

Whether you have always wanted to start a business, or have just taken your first steps into entrepreneurship, they will give you the skills, information and know-how you need to build a viable business.

The range of free services includes: 

  • quarterly free workshops for aspiring entrepreneurs and early stage start-ups - we offer two workshops (detailed below) to cover all the fundamentals of running a start-up
  • walk-in access to business resources and databases like COBRA
  • one-to-one business information sessions with borough SME Champions 
  • a programme of events, including live-screenings from the British Library's Business & IP Centre

You will also meet like-minded people and gain the confidence you need to make your business a success!
